Who's Hiding? Summary

Who's Hiding? by Satoru Onishi

Who's hiding? Who's crying? Who's backwards? Look carefully! Is it dog, tiger, hippo, zebra, bear, reindeer, kangaroo, lion, rabbit, giraffe, monkey, bull, rhino, pig, sheep, hen, elephant, or cat? Can you tell? Look again...18 fun-loving animals can be found on each question-posing page, sending readers into an up-close, attention-to-detail discovery. This book is fantastic to read aloud, especially when you get to the final two pages: Whose eyes? Children learn the names of animals, to recognise expressions, colours, and how to count.

About Satoru Onishi

Satoru Onishi was born in 1955. He studied art in Tokyo, Japan, and now works as a professional illustrator.
